Betty Shelby Found Not Guilty in Shooting Death of Unarmed Black Motorist Terence Crutcher
The jury in the trial of Tulsa, Okla., Police Officer Betty Shelby deliberated for nine hours Wednesday before finding her not guilty of manslaughter in the shooting death of unarmed black motorist Terence Crutcher.
